Abstract

The invention discloses a system for mechanically pumping the excreta of fish bodies in a feeding cage, which comprises at least one aquaculture net cage, and a floating device and a fish excreta collector which are arranged corresponding to the aquaculture net cage, wherein the floating device is fixed and suspended on water by a mounting bracket at the top of the aquaculture net cage; the aquaculture net cage and the fish excreta collector are connected with the floating device respectively; an excreta collection barrel is arranged at the bottom of the fish excreta collector, and is connected with an excreta pumping machine by an excreta pumping pipe; and the fish excreta collector is provided with a vibrating retaining ring which is connected with a vibrating rope. The system can perform excreta pumping processing on a plurality of groups of aquaculture net cages by utilizing only one excreta pumping machine, and has the characteristics of high excreta pumping efficiency, cost reduction, higher pumping mechanization and automation degree, convenience for the maintenance of the excreta pumping machine, more rational aquaculture structure due to the combination of an inner aquaculture cage and an outer aquaculture cage, and higher environmental friendliness of cage aquaculture and healthier and more scientific aquaculture due to the organic separation of the aquaculture net cage and the fish excreta collector.

As shown in Figure 1, a kind of bait throwing in net cage fish body excreta mechanization extraction system, the buoyant device 3 and the fish excrement gatherer 4 that comprise fish culture net cage and corresponding setting with fish culture net cage, net cage 1 and outer net cage 2 in described fish culture net cage comprises, net cage 1 is arranged in the outer net cage 2 in described, net cage 1 is connected by connecting line 16 with outer net cage 2 in described, interior net cage 1 and outside leave certain space between the net cage 2, described fish culture net cage is by the combination of inside and outside net cage, interior case is cultured the main kind of supporting, outer container is cultured filter-feeding and ominivore-fish, the residual bait that case overflows like this can be cleared up by the fish of outer container, reduces the pollution of residual bait to water body, also increased simultaneously the added value of outer container cultured fishes, simultaneously, outer container can also prevent running away of interior case fish, has increased security performance; Outside described, be provided with cat stone around net cage 2 bottoms, play the fixedly effect of fish culture net cage.
Wherein, described buoyant device 3 fixedly is suspended in the water surface by the fixed mount at fish culture net cage top, and described fish culture net cage is connected with buoyant device 3 respectively with fish excrement gatherer 4.Described buoyant device adopts stainless steel tube or hard plastic tube to couple together effectively with bigger devices of buoyancy such as foam ball float or metal keg floats, on buoyant device, also can lay flat board, as producing and the life place, fish culture net cage and fish excrement gatherer 4 are respectively with after buoyant device is connected, it is suspended in the water, can sink; Be provided with night-soil collecting bucket 5 in described fish excrement gatherer 4 bottoms, night-soil collecting bucket 5 bottoms are funnel type, described night-soil collecting bucket 5 is taken out soil pipe 6 and is taken out excrement machine 7 and be connected by emersed, the described excrement machine 7 of taking out is communicated with the liquid dung piece-rate system by pipeline again, described liquid dung piece-rate system is made up of some liquid dung separation bags 12, below described liquid dung separation bag 12, be provided with liquid dung separating tank 17, like this, be drained into by the liquid dung of extracting out in the night-soil collecting bucket and carry out separating treatment timely in the liquid dung piece-rate system; The described excrement machine of taking out adopts self-priming self-priming no-blocking pollution discharging pump, the described soil pipe 6 of taking out is communicated with the through hole of night-soil collecting bucket 5 bottoms by U type tube connector 10, so only takes out the excrement machine with opening, and the fish excrement in the night-soil collecting bucket just is drawn out of the water surface, make the fish excrement break away from water body, effectively prevent and treat of the pollution of fish excrement water body.Gauge tap 15 is set on take out soil pipe, can controls the extracting of fish excrement easily; The described soil pipe 6 of taking out is bundled in night-soil collecting bucket 5, fish excrement gatherer 4, the fish culture net cage outside successively by annular binding 14, makes like this to take out soil pipe and can swing along with net cage, can prevent effectively that stormy waves is to taking out the destruction of soil pipe; On described fish excrement gatherer 4, also be provided with vibration clasp 8, be connected with vibration rope 9 on the described vibration clasp 8,, make the fish excrement that adheres on the fish excrement gatherer 4 fall into the stercoroma bucket by of the vibration of vibration rope to fish excrement gatherer 4.

Described fish excrement gatherer 4 is funnel type, and its inclined angle alpha is the core parameter of collection excrement efficient, and the inclination angle number of degrees are low, and the height of fish excrement gatherer is just very low, and the cost of gathering unit is just very low, and safety coefficient such as wind wave resistance is just high, but collection efficiency is on the low side; The inclination angle number of degrees are big, and the height of collecting bag is just very high, and the cost of gathering unit is just high, and the safety coefficient of wind wave resistance etc. is just low, but collection efficiency wants high.We draw when the inclined angle alpha of fish excrement gatherer is 60 ° according to experiment, and its collection efficiency and wind wave resistance safety coefficient are the most suitable, below are contrast experiment's data of different inclination angle:

Wherein, leave gap 11 between described outer net cage 2 and the fish excrement gatherer 4, making fish culture net cage lower floor have water body like this flows, make breeding water body keep higher dissolved oxygen, avoid collecting the pollution of colostomy bag simultaneously, can also avoid simultaneously the related destruction of big current such as flood the main body net cage to the fish culture net cage water body; Described fish excrement gatherer 4 upper end open are greater than the fish culture net cage bottom margin, and the gap 11 beyond the present embodiment between net cage and the fish excrement gatherer 4 is an example for 2m, and its outer net cage 2 separates with unseparated contrast experiment's data as follows with fish excrement gatherer 4:

Be provided with biologic float bed at described fish culture net cage periphery, described biologic float bed with bamboo or plastic tube as the floating bed framework, at the adherance of framework upper berth one deck filler as plant, water plants 13 is endured in plantation on adherance, the fish excrement that water plants on biologic float bed can absorb fish excrement gathering unit not to be had to have collected decomposes the nutritive element in the water body, and is better to the purification maintenance effects of breeding water body like this.
As shown in Figure 2, for many groups fish culture net cage taking out soil pipe 6 back in parallel and taking out excrement machine 7 and be connected by correspondence, take out on the soil pipe 6 respectively described that correspondence is provided with gauge tap 15,, utilize one to take out the excrement machine and just can take out excrement a plurality of fish culture net cages by the control of corresponding gauge tap.
